LEGISLATIVE COUNCIL.

Thursday. The Council met at 2.30 p.m. BILLS. The Law Practitioners Bill, the Timaru Harbor Board Endowment Bill, the Law as to Fixtures Amendment Bill, and the Distress for Rent Abolition Bill were read a first time. The Timaru Mechanics' Institute Act Amendment Bill was read a ■eoond time. The Drainage Bill and the Taranaki County Council Loan Bill were *cad a third time. The Volunteer Bill passed through committee with many amendments. GAMING- AND LOTTERIES BILL. The Gaming and Lotteries Bill was received from the Lower House with numerous amendments, to some of which the Council assented ; others, however were not agreed to, and managers were appointed to draw up reasons for the disagreement. The Council rose at 6 o'olook.
